Not a Moment To Spare

It’s now, and not a moment to spare
Trust little of the future 
–Distant and nowhere near. 

It’s now. Refuse to put it off
Seize today’s mirth
Squander today’s worth.

Tomorrow never fixates, always unsure
Changes by the minute
In a blink, in a heartbeat.

Blaze today, savor the moment
Tomorrow’s dream is a fool’s errand
Hardly in the grip of your hand.
	
Bask in today’s glory like it is your last
Cast away all the worry
Take it, and take ‘em all,  time is running fast. 
 
It’s now! –And not a moment to spare
So much of the future
There’s not a need to prepare.
